+/*----- Macros ------------------------------------------------------------*/
+
+/* --- @OFB_DECL@ --- *
+ *
+ * Arguments: @PRE@, @pre@ = prefixes for block cipher definitions
+ *
+ * Use: Makes declarations for output feedback mode.
+ */
+
+#define OFB_DECL(PRE, pre) \
+ \
+/* --- Output feedback context --- */ \
+ \
+typedef struct pre##_ofbctx { \
+ pre##_ctx ctx; /* Underlying cipher context */ \
+ unsigned off; /* Current offset in buffer */ \
+ octet iv[PRE##_BLKSZ]; /* Output buffer and IV */ \
+} pre##_ofbctx; \
+ \
+/* --- @pre_ofbgetiv@ --- * \
+ * \
+ * Arguments: @const pre_ofbctx *ctx@ = pointer to OFB context block \
+ * @void *iv@ = pointer to output data block \
+ * \
+ * Returns: --- \
+ * \
+ * Use: Reads the currently set IV. Reading and setting an IV \
+ * is not transparent to the cipher. It will add a `step' \
+ * which must be matched by a similar operation during \
+ * decryption. \
+ */ \
+ \
+extern void pre##_ofbgetiv(const pre##_ofbctx */*ctx*/, \
+ void */*iv*/); \
+ \
+/* --- @pre_ofbsetiv@ --- * \
+ * \
+ * Arguments: @pre_ofbctx *ctx@ = pointer to OFB context block \
+ * @cnost void *iv@ = pointer to IV to set \
+ * \
+ * Returns: --- \
+ * \
+ * Use: Sets the IV to use for subsequent encryption. \
+ */ \
+ \
+extern void pre##_ofbsetiv(pre##_ofbctx */*ctx*/, \
+ const void */*iv*/); \
+ \
+/* --- @pre_ofbbdry@ --- * \
+ * \
+ * Arguments: @pre_ofbctx *ctx@ = pointer to OFB context block \
+ * \
+ * Returns: --- \
+ * \
+ * Use: Inserts a boundary during encryption. Successful \
+ * decryption must place a similar boundary. \
+ */ \
+ \
+extern void pre##_ofbbdry(pre##_ofbctx */*ctx*/); \
+ \
+/* --- @pre_ofbsetkey@ --- * \
+ * \
+ * Arguments: @pre_ofbctx *ctx@ = pointer to OFB context block \
+ * @const pre_ctx *k@ = pointer to cipher context \
+ * \
+ * Returns: --- \
+ * \
+ * Use: Sets the OFB context to use a different cipher key. \
+ */ \
+ \
+extern void pre##_ofbsetkey(pre##_ofbctx */*ctx*/, \
+ const pre##_ctx */*k*/); \
+ \
+/* --- @pre_ofbinit@ --- * \
+ * \
+ * Arguments: @pre_ofbctx *ctx@ = pointer to cipher context \
+ * @const void *key@ = pointer to the key buffer \
+ * @size_t sz@ = size of the key \
+ * @const void *iv@ = pointer to initialization vector \
+ * \
+ * Returns: --- \
+ * \
+ * Use: Initializes a OFB context ready for use. You should \
+ * ensure that the IV chosen is unique: reusing an IV will \
+ * compromise the security of the entire plaintext. This \
+ * is equivalent to calls to @pre_init@, @pre_ofbsetkey@ \
+ * and @pre_ofbsetiv@. \
+ */ \
+ \
+extern void pre##_ofbinit(pre##_ofbctx */*ctx*/, \
+ const void */*key*/, size_t /*sz*/, \
+ const void */*iv*/); \
+ \
+/* --- @pre_ofbencrypt@ --- * \
+ * \
+ * Arguments: @pre_ofbctx *ctx@ = pointer to OFB context block \
+ * @const void *src@ = pointer to source data \
+ * @void *dest@ = pointer to destination data \
+ * @size_t sz@ = size of block to be encrypted \
+ * \
+ * Returns: --- \
+ * \
+ * Use: Encrypts or decrypts a block with a block cipher in OFB \
+ * mode: encryption and decryption are the same in OFB. \
+ * The destination may be null to just churn the feedback \
+ * round for a bit. The source may be null to use the \
+ * cipher as a random data generator. \
+ */ \
+ \
+extern void pre##_ofbencrypt(pre##_ofbctx */*ctx*/, \
+ const void */*src*/, void */*dest*/, \
+ size_t /*sz*/); \
+ \
+/* --- @pre_ofbrand@ --- * \
+ * \
+ * Arguments: @const void *k@ = pointer to key material \
+ * @size_t sz@ = size of key material \
+ * \
+ * Returns: Pointer to generic random number generator interface. \
+ * \
+ * Use: Creates a random number interface wrapper around an \
+ * OFB-mode block cipher. \
+ */ \
+ \
+extern grand *pre##_ofbrand(const void */*k*/, size_t /*sz*/); \
+ \
+/* --- Generic cipher interface --- */ \
+ \
+extern const gccipher pre##_ofb;
